Why are willows always planted by the river?

Willow needs water and has good water resistance. When flooded, it can produce many adventitious roots floating in the water and exercise the function of absorbing and transporting nutrients, so willow is suitable for planting by the river. In addition, from the perspective of geomantic omen and folklore, there is a superstition that willow and pine trees are hidden houses and are not suitable for planting in the houses of the living.
